Direct answer
A kilowatt-hour measures total electric energy consumed over time—one kW drawn for one hour. Laundromat kWh accumulates from washers, electric or heat-pump water heating, lighting, HVAC, vending, and dryer motors even when drying heat is gas-fired. kWh differs from kW demand, which bills peak interval draw.
Definition: Kilowatt-hour
Energy charges multiply kWh by supply and delivery rates. EPA WaterSense materials note water heating dominates much commercial washer operating energy, so hot-water cycles materially affect kWh even at gas-dryer stores.
Owners compare kWh across months after normalizing billing days and read types. Solar offsets kWh more readily than it reduces demand peaks on many sites.
Laundromat example
A gas-dryer store still registers 9,500 kWh in August from air conditioning, fluorescent and LED lighting, and electric water heaters serving 40-pound washers, while gas therms cover drying heat.
